diff --git a/src/main/java/de/ph87/tools/group/GroupService.java b/src/main/java/de/ph87/tools/group/GroupService.java index 5297a76..35bf00b 100644 --- a/src/main/java/de/ph87/tools/group/GroupService.java +++ b/src/main/java/de/ph87/tools/group/GroupService.java @@ -79,7 +79,7 @@ public class GroupService { public GroupDto changePassword(@NonNull final String privateUuid, @NonNull final GroupChangePasswordInbound request) { final User user = userService.getByPrivateUuidOrThrow(privateUuid); final Group group = groupOfUserService.getGroupOfUser(request.uuid, user); - if (group.isOwnedBy(user)) { + if (!group.isOwnedBy(user)) { throw new ResponseStatusException(HttpStatus.FORBIDDEN); } group.setPassword(request.password);